The invention discloses a traffic light timing optimization method based on a scheme library and a regional evaluation particle swarm algorithm, and mainly relates to the field of smart cities and intelligent optimization. A mathematical model is often used in an existing traffic light timing scheme, precision is poor, an optimal timing scheme cannot be found, the timeliness of a traffic light optimization problem cannot be considered in an intelligent optimization algorithm for the traffic light timing scheme at present, and therefore the scheme cannot be given in time. According to the method, a regional evaluation particle swarm optimization algorithm is adopted, the number of times of adaptive value evaluation is fully reduced in a clustering mode, and a good optimization result can be obtained in the limited number of times of adaptive value evaluation; meanwhile, a scheme library is provided, and the purpose of giving out a timing scheme in real time according to the traffic flow is achieved in a mode of pre-storing existing traffic flow-timing scheme pairs.
